Clinical definition (Orphanet)

Inhalational botulism is a man-made form of botulism, a rare acquired neuromuscular junction disease with descending flaccid paralysis caused by botulinum neurotoxins (BoNTs).

How rare: <1 / 1 000 000 — fewer than one in a million. In a city the size of Kolkata, that might mean on the order of fifteen people.
